It would seem BitTornado 0.3.17-1 on feisty doesn't actually store any configuration settings in one's home folder.
Actually, on the first run, BT creates the .BitTornado folder within one's home, and creates a config.gui.ini file which does store its settings; but if one changes them in the GUI and tries to save them, nothing happens. The file remains untouched, and thus all settings are reset to the defaults upon restarting the program. While not really a showstopper, this bug is at the very least a major nuisance.
